Honda Passport vs Jeep Grand Cherokee Mechanical Specs

The Passport’s mechanical advantage starts with its second-generation i-VTM4® all-wheel-drive system. Unlike basic AWD that primarily reacts to slip, i-VTM4® can actively apportion power across the rear axle to help the SUV pivot into a turn and claw forward through off-camber or loose surfaces—this is the kind of behind-the-scenes sophistication you feel in the wheel and the seat of your pants on the winding two-lanes outside Dover, OH. Pair that with an available Off-Road Tuned Suspension on TrailSport trims and you get compliant control over washboard or broken pavement without sacrificing composure on I-77. Honda’s available TrailWatch™ camera adds confidence on narrow trails or steep driveways by showing low-speed, forward and side views you can’t see over the hood. Jeep’s Grand Cherokee answers with available Quadra-Lift air suspension, multiple 4×4 systems, and terrain settings, each effective when you’re building a premium off-road package. The Jeep approach layers options; the Honda approach gives you the most critical capability across trims and augments it with accessories that are engineered to work together. For many, that integrated simplicity is the more satisfying long-term choice.

Safety – Honda Passport vs Jeep Grand Cherokee

Every Passport includes Honda Sensing®—a comprehensive suite that typically features Collision Mitigation Braking System, Road Departure Mitigation, Lane Keeping Assist System, Adaptive Cruise Control, and more, all integrated to work smoothly across traffic, highway, and neighborhood speeds. The consistent, standard approach is part of why families trust the Passport, and why our team at Parkway Honda emphasizes it during test drives. Available Blind Spot Information with Cross Traffic Monitor and multi-angle camera views bring helpful awareness in parking lots and on multi-lane highways. Jeep equips the Grand Cherokee with a broad catalog of safety and security tech as well, including available Hands-Free Active Driving Assist, a 360-degree camera, and other driver attention aids on upper trims. It’s an impressive list—often optional and tied to specific models or packages. Honda’s philosophy is clear: build driver confidence from the base up so every Passport buyer leaves with the same core protection. If you value straightforward safety content without climbing the trim ladder, the Passport delivers exactly that, backed by the thoughtful calibration Honda is known for at Parkway Honda.
